01 / PROJECT SUMMARY

What the public record shows.

AID1 DataBank is tracked in Ashburn, Loudoun County, VA. The current public-record status is Proposed. The record identifies developer: GI TC ASHBURN LLC; owner or tenant: Undisclosed. The reported capacity is 70 MW. This page cites 3 public sources.

Latest status detail: Shown as "Storage Warehouse"
